About the role
As a character and prop designer, you will work alongside the art lead and/or assistant director / director to provide a variety of designs for characters and props.

What you'll be doing
Work under the art lead and/or assistant director’s guidance and supervision to develop character and prop designs.
Work to a brief and create a variety of designs for each character and prop.
Troubleshoot and adapt existing models and help the team find ways to adjust designs for ease of animation.
Assist the art lead in integrating the characters, their shapes and visual motifs to the overall style of the production.
Work as part of a design team to maximize the contributions of each designer for the production.
Create model sheets that cover the following areas:
Character turnarounds (front, back, side/profile, three-quarter views as well as any other special poses/views needed)
Character poses (full body or hands and feet only)
Face shapes and expressions
Character and Prop line-up showing the scale of all characters and props in relation to each other
Prop turn arounds (front, back, side/profile and whatever special views are required)
